Superintendent Finalists Announced
At the Special Board of Education meeting on May 8, the Board of Education selected the following candidates to be asked to return for a second interview: Dr. Wayne Anderson, Dr. Jeff Hall and Mr. Michael Sharrow. The second interviews will take place at 5:00 p.m. on May 20th, 21st and 22nd.
![]() Dr. Wayne Anderson Mt. Horeb Area School District Mt. Horeb, Wisconsin Interview: May 20th, 5:00 P.M. |
![]() Dr. Jeff Hall Swartz Creek Community Schools Swartz Creek, Michigan Interview: May 21st, 5:00 P.M. |
![]() Mr. Michael Sharrow Algonac Community Schools Algonac, Michigan Interview: May 22nd, 5:00 P.M. |

2013 Gerstacker Proficiency Awards Presented
Four Midland Public Schools teachers were honored on Thursday, May 9, with the 58th Annual Gerstacker Teacher Proficiency Awards held at the Griswold Lecture Hall at Northwood University.
The awards “recognize contributions by exemplary teachers beyond the ordinary level of professional performance,” and are made possible by the support of the Carl and Esther Gerstacker Donor-Advised Community Foundation. The winners receive a cash award to be used for travel, continuing education, research in education or other appropriate purposes, along with an engraved permanent testimonial.
We would like to congratulate this year’s recipients: Wendy LaCourt, Ellen Flegenheimer-Riggle, Linda Murray, and Kathy Romain.

Superintendent Search Update
At the Monday, April 29, Board of Education meeting, Board members voted to interview the following superintendent candidates:
- Dr. Wayne Anderson, Mt. Horeb Area School District
- Dr. Jeffrey J. Hall, Swartz Creek Community Schools
- Mr. Rick Seebeck II, Gladwin Community Schools
- Mr. Michael Sharrow, Algonac Community Schools
- Mrs. Cindy Weber, Durand Area Schools
